A Sleigh Ride For Georgia

by Kimberly Grist

2024

Abandoned as a child and raised in a children's home, Georgia longs for love and acceptance but trusts no easy promise. A reclusive blacksmith who prefers horses to people is the last man she expects to matter.

Series background & context

Sleigh Ride is a winter romance series that makes travel itself part of the courtship. A sleigh ride can be festive, practical, dangerous, intimate, or all four at once. That gives the series a built-in mood of cold air, close quarters, and chances for people to end up talking more honestly than they might by the light of day in a crowded room. Kimberly Grist's A Sleigh Ride For Georgia fits that setup while adding her usual interest in capable women and guarded men.

In her story, the heroine is a baker who was abandoned as a child and raised in a children's home. She longs for love and acceptance, but has learned not to depend too heavily on promises. The hero is a blacksmith who prefers horses to people and is in no hurry to entertain romance. Put those two in a winter setting with sleighs, work, and unavoidable contact, and the emotional shape of the story starts to appear.

Winter does a lot of heavy lifting here.

It raises the need for shelter, shortens tempers, and makes companionship feel a little more urgent. In a series like this, a sleigh is not only a quaint detail. It is a vehicle for getting stranded, rescued, seen, or softened. A ride through snow can become the moment when two guarded people finally stop pretending they do not care.

The appeal of Sleigh Ride is likely its balance of coziness and vulnerability. Readers can expect snowbound emotion, holiday atmosphere, and heroes who have to be tugged toward tenderness. The heroines, meanwhile, tend to bring warmth of a harder-earned kind.

If you like historical romance that feels wintry without losing its grit, Sleigh Ride should be appealing. The snow may set the mood, but the real warmth comes from watching two lonely people decide they might not have to travel alone anymore.
